Imagine buying electricity at midnight prices and selling it at premium afternoon rates – that's exactly what modern high-yield energy storage projects are achieving. Take the Sichuan facility that earned ¥1 million monthly just by charging during off-peak hours and discharging when the grid needs it most[1]. Like a financial trader exploiting market fluctuations, these projects turn timing into cold, hard cash. [2025-05-30 11:08]
